Donald Trump and First Lady Melania Trump experienced an awkward moment when the escalator they were riding stopped
During their visit to the UN headquarters, President Donald Trump and his wife Melania Trump experienced an awkward moment when an escalator stopped just as they were to get on.
Although it was a minor incident, it was captured on several Cameras present at the headquarters of the international organization and in his speech before the General Assembly, Trump made reference to the mishap with his characteristic sarcasm:
“These are the two things I got from the United Nations: a malfunctioning escalator and a malfunctioning teleprompter.”
Hours later, White House administrator Karoline Leavitt said that if someone at the UN intentionally turned off the escalator they got on, that person should be fired.
